THE NEW ROSES
from the beautiful German region of Rheingau are one of the most exciting and successful new rock acts from Germany. Their song "Without A Trace" was featured on the soundtrack of the US cult-series "SONS OF ANARCHY" and was selected as the official song for the German DVD trailer campaign.Musically THE NEW ROSES are explosive like TNT. They fit in the same pocket as Guns N‘ Roses, AC/DC, Kid Rock, Aerosmith, Metallica, or The Black Crowes, but with their own unique style.Over the last years, their fan base has grown constantly as they've toured relentlessly throughout GAS, France and Spain. In 2015 alone, the band performed over 80 concerts! Highlights in 2015 included performances at the UEFA CHAMPIONS FESTIVAL in Berlin, a headliner show at the HAMBURG HARLEY DAYS with approximately 500.000 visitors, SWISS HARLEY DAYS, LOVE RIDE FESTIVAL (CH) and lots of special guest shows with ACCEPT and MOLLY HATCHET. In February 2015, THE NEW ROSES signed an international record deal with NAPALM RECORDS (Universal). The album “Dead Man's Voice” was released in Feb 2016 and entered the Official German Album Top 100 Sales Charts at #36.The album reviews are slamming. Germany's biggest rock-magazine METAL HAMMER wrote: "THE NEW ROSES are a complete exceptional phenomena in the German rockscene" - EMP (Germanys‘ biggest rock mailorder) wrote: "THE NEW ROSES accomplished it with their thrilling sound to bring stadium rock back to the showstage", CLASSIC ROCK MAGAZINE: "Forceful rock-hymnes consisting of passion, driving guitars and a unique voice make the new THE NEW ROSES album a real rock jewel", the biggest rock magazine from France, ROCK HARD FRANCE, wrote: "THE NEW ROSES are the best hard rock band of today!" and chose “Dead Man's Voice”as album of the month! In 2016, THE NEW ROSES performed over 100 shows in Europe including support slots for THE DEAD DASIES, TREMONTI, SAXON, and Y&T, in addition to performances on huge festival stages in Germany and France. The continuous touring has turned THE NEW ROSES into a solid rock act in Germany and has put them on their way to conquer new territories like France, Spain, Switzerland and Austria.

In 2017, many new countries were added to their tour schedule, such as UK, Czech Republic, the Netherlands or even Afghanistan, where THE NEW ROSES played two shows for the international troops of operation "Resolute Support" in "Camp Marmal", Mazar-i Sharif. Their performances at Hellfest Open Air in France and Hard Rock Hell Festival in the UK have further solidified their mainstay in the European rock scene.In 2017, THE NEW ROSES reached their next milestone with the worldwide release of their new album “One More For The Road” via Napalm Records on 25th of August, which hit the Official German Album Top 20 Sales Charts and reached more than 2000 spins on German radio stations. The following "One More For The Road Tour" lead the band through Germany, Austria and Switzerland and became the most successful tour in the band's history so far, with sold out shows in Munich, Hamburg, Berlin, Cologne and Mannheim.In 2018 THE NEW ROSES toured again all over Europe. Beside headliner shows in Germany, France and UK, THE NEW ROSES played a 4-weeks European tour as special guests for THE DEAD DAISIES in April/May, before hitting national and international festival stages like SWEDEN ROCK, OPEN ROAD FEST (HU), MASTERS OF ROCK (CZ), MATAPALOZ, ROCK OF AGES, ROCK HARD FESTIVAL, WERNER DAS RENNEN, etc. in Summer. In November 2018 THE NEW ROSES became the first German band ever to be invited to the KISS KRUISE, a 5-days Rock festival boat trip from Miami to the Bahamas.In 2019 THE NEW ROSES opened for Scorpions and KISS in German, Austrian and Swiss arenas and released their 4th longplayer and German Top10 album "Nothing But Wild", whose 1st single "Down By The River" became a hit on German rock radio stations and helped the band to sell out shows in cities like Hamburg, Berlin and Munich. Between that tour the band flew to Miami again to take part in KISS Kruise IV to Jamaica.After the departure of leadguitarist Norman Bites during the Covid pandemic and the return of founding member Dizzy Daniels THE NEW ROSES in 2022, the band played postponed headliner and festival shows from 2020 such as Rockfest Barcelona (with KISS, Megadeth and Judas Priest), but also opened for KISS in Germany and Belgium.The new album "Sweet Poison" is supposed to be released on October, 21st.
